What is Disa valve called?
The air adjustment unit, also known as the disa valve, controls the path of air through the plenum, regulating the intake manifold pressure to provide greater torque around town and less torque on the highway. What does DISA stand for?
The defense information systems agency is a combat support agency that connects the u.s military and government with it and communications support. In response to communication problems faced by the military during the Vietnam War, the agency was created in 1960. DISA is responsible for supporting the Department of Defense (DoD) in the areas of communications, information technology, and information assurance.
